BMO Financial Group's Pat Cronin and Maria Tihotchi Awarded by Women in Capital Markets

TORONTO, Nov. 28, 2018 /CNW/ - BMO Financial Group today announced that Pat Cronin and Maria Tihotchi were honoured by Women in Capital Markets (WCM) for leadership and high performance, respectively, at a ceremony Tuesday evening in Toronto.

"Setting new norms that pave the way for women is not possible without leadership. Pat and Maria are using their influence to meaningfully bring down barriers and encourage more women to consider careers in the industry," said Darryl White, Chief Executive Officer, BMO Financial Group. "Today, 40 per cent of the leaders who are driving BMO's performance and growth are women – and our work continues. Change agents like Pat and Maria fuel our commitment to advancing the next generation of talented women to leadership roles. We salute them both."

Pat Cronin, formerly Group Head of BMO Capital Markets and recently appointed to Chief Risk Officer of BMO Financial Group, received the WCM Award for Transformational Leadership – which recognizes senior executives who have made a lasting contribution to gender diversity and inclusion at their firm and are driving organizational and cultural change with measurable impacts.

Mr. Cronin has demonstrated leadership and commitment to raising awareness and implementing programs that support diversity and inclusion at BMO. For example:

  • He is a member of the WCM Advisory Council and actively supports BMO's involvement with WCM as a Gold Corporate Champion and founding partner of the "Return to Bay Street" Program
  • He championed the development of the New York City-based Financial Women's Association's (FWA) "Back2Business" Program. BMO Capital Markets is also a member of the FWA's President's Circle
  • He implemented an Inclusion Learning Series that most notably included "Unconscious Bias" training for every North American employee in BMO Capital Markets

Maria Tihotchi, Director, Global Structured Products, Trading Products, BMO Capital Markets, received the WCM Rising Star Award – which recognizes high-performing professionals whose entrepreneurial spirit, leadership and social responsibility have made a unique contribution to the capital markets industry.

Ms. Tihotchi was honoured for her passion about giving back to her community, her work in encouraging young women to consider careers in capital markets, and advancing gender diversity within the bank and in the industry more broadly. She actively supports the advancement of other women by serving as a mentor and trusted advisor to peers, junior colleagues and to new recruits in BMO Capital Markets' Rotational Program.

All WCM award winners are nominated based on an extensive set of criteria and then selected by a jury panel.

BMO Financial Group's Commitment to Diversity

Diversity and inclusion are core BMO values – drivers of sustainability that influence business strategy. BMO creates an environment where everyone is valued, respected and heard; where employees can bring their best selves to work – for the benefit of their co-workers, their communities and customers, and themselves. As a result of sustained efforts to build a diverse workforce and create a culture of inclusion, BMO has seen strong progress against diversity and inclusion goals. Key highlights include:

  • 40 per cent of senior leadership roles are held by women
  • 25 per cent of senior roles are held by Minorities or Persons of Colour
  • Bloomberg recognized BMO as one of the top-ranked Financial Institutions for gender equality for three years in a row
  • Thomson Reuters recognized BMO as one of the most diverse and inclusive companies in the world for two years in a row
  • BMO is a two-time winner of the Catalyst award
  • BMO was recognized as one of the best places to work for LGBTQ Employees by The Human Rights Campaign Foundation

About BMO Capital Markets
BMO Capital Markets is a leading, full-service North American-based financial services provider offering corporate, institutional and government clients access to a complete range of products and services including equity and debt underwriting, corporate lending and project financing, mergers and acquisitions advisory services, securitization, treasury management, market risk management, debt and equity research and institutional sales and trading. With approximately 2,500 professionals in 30 locations around the world, including 16 offices in North America, BMO Capital Markets works proactively with clients to provide innovative and integrated financial solutions.

BMO Capital Markets is a member of BMO Financial Group (NYSE, TSX: BMO) one of the largest diversified financial services providers in North America with $765 billion total assets as at July 31, 2018.

About WCM
With more than 1500 members, WCM is the largest network of professional women in the Canadian financial sector and the voice of advocacy for women in our industry. WCM is committed to the advancement of women in the capital markets and to increasing the number of women in senior leadership roles in the Canadian economy. We work with our partners, members and the broader public to promote initiatives that successfully increase the economic empowerment of women and move the dial on women's representation and impact in the boardrooms and executive suites of corporate Canada.
